By a News Reporter-Staff News Editor at Robotics & Machine Learning Daily News Daily News – Current study results on artificial in telligence have been published. According to news reporting originating from Pri nce Sattam Bin Abdulaziz University by NewsRx correspondents, research stated, “ The objective of this research is to investigate how artificial intelligence (AI ) might improve HR procedures and increase employee engagement and productivity in organizations. AI-powered tools and applications used in the current era beco me a decisive point for businesses and its performance may impact employees’ job engagement and job performance.” The news journalists obtained a quote from the research from Prince Sattam Bin A bdulaziz University: “The use of artificial intelligence in an organization’s ac tivities to manage human resources in the areas of employee engagement, job secu rity, employee performance, particularly in the process of lowering staff worklo ad, and enhancing business performance. The study involved full-time employees w ith experience using artificial intelligence powered software in Indian multinat ional corporation. The research data was collected from 310 employees from multi national cooperation. The findings demonstrate that artificial intelligence perf ormance had a significant impact on employee’s performance and job engagement, b oth of which were highly correlated with performance at work evaluation. AI has a positive impact on employee engagement and company performance. Artificial int elligence and job performance were significantly related with job engagement and service performance. Additionally, job security had a significant impact on inc reasing employees’ job engagement and service quality.”
